Modern minimalism emphasizes clean lines, neutral colors, and functional furniture. This style is perfect for small spaces as it creates a sense of openness and airiness.

Scandinavian Design

Scandinavian design focuses on simplicity, functionality, and natural materials. It often incorporates light wood tones, soft textures, and muted colors.

Mid-Century Modern

Mid-century modern style is characterized by organic shapes, tapered legs, and bold colors. This style can add a touch of vintage charm to your small living room.

Color Schemes for Every Room

Light and Airy

Light colors like white, cream, and pale gray can make your small living room feel larger and brighter.

Bold and Vibrant

If you want to add personality to your space, consider using bold colors like deep blue, emerald green, or mustard yellow.

Earthy Tones

Earthy tones like brown, beige, and olive green can create a warm and inviting atmosphere.

Maximizing Small Spaces

Mirrors

Mirrors can make your small living room appear larger by reflecting light and creating the illusion of space.

Vertical Space

Utilize vertical space by adding shelves or wall-mounted storage solutions.

Open Floor Plan

If possible, create an open floor plan to make your living room feel more spacious.
